
Ruby Labs
Senior Full-Stack Developer
USARemotePosted 26 days ago$120,000 – $200,000
Full TimeSeniorRemoteUS
See how this job matches your profile
Sign in for an AI-powered fit score, breakdown, and a tailored resume.
Job Description
About usRuby Labs is a leading tech company that creates and operates innovative consumer products. We offer a diverse range of opportunities across the health, education, and entertainment industries
Key Highlights
- Take ownership of core product components from concept to deployment.
- Collaborate with the Product team to design scalable and maintainable architectures.
- Participate in (and lead) code reviews and ensure best practices across the team.
- Mentor junior and mid-level developers, providing guidance and fostering growth.
- Contribute to hiring and onboarding new team members.
Qualifications
Required Qualifications
- Core Technical SkillsAt least 6 years of experience of overall full-stack application development.At least 2 years of experience with Next.js.Strong expertise in JavaScript/TypeScript and modern ReactJS.Experience leading a small team in a continuous deployment environment.Experience with CI/CD pipelines, Docker, and cloud infrastructure (preferably AWS, Cloudflare).Solid understanding of PostgreSQL and Redis, including performance tuning and schema design.Experience with A/B testing frameworks and using analytics to drive product decisions.Familiarity with CMS (preferably Payload).
- At least 6 years of experience of overall full-stack application development.
- At least 2 years of experience with Next.js.
- Strong expertise in JavaScript/TypeScript and modern ReactJS.
- Experience leading a small team in a continuous deployment environment.
- Experience with CI/CD pipelines, Docker, and cloud infrastructure (preferably AWS, Cloudflare).
- Solid understanding of PostgreSQL and Redis, including performance tuning and schema design.
- Experience with A/B testing frameworks and using analytics to drive product decisions.
- Familiarity with CMS (preferably Payload).
- Leadership & CollaborationDemonstrated ability to mentor other engineers and elevate team performance.Clear communication style, able to explain complex topics clearly and concisely.A proactive mindset, you spot issues before they become problems and take ownership.Comfortable making technical decisions and defending them with logic and data.Experience leading teams or projects.
- Demonstrated ability to mentor other engineers and elevate team performance.
- Clear communication style, able to explain complex topics clearly and concisely.
- A proactive mindset, you spot issues before they become problems and take ownership.
- Comfortable making technical decisions and defending them with logic and data.
- Experience leading teams or projects.
- Core Technical SkillsAt least 6 years of experience of overall full-stack application development.At least 2 years of experience with Next.js.Strong expertise in JavaScript/TypeScript and modern ReactJS.Experience leading a small team in a continuous deployment environment.Experience with CI/CD pipelines, Docker, and cloud infrastructure (preferably AWS, Cloudflare).Solid understanding of PostgreSQL and Redis, including performance tuning and schema design.Experience with A/B testing frameworks and using analytics to drive product decisions.Familiarity with CMS (preferably Payload).
- At least 6 years of experience of overall full-stack application development.
- At least 2 years of experience with Next.js.
- Strong expertise in JavaScript/TypeScript and modern ReactJS.
- Experience leading a small team in a continuous deployment environment.
- Experience with CI/CD pipelines, Docker, and cloud infrastructure (preferably AWS, Cloudflare).
- Solid understanding of PostgreSQL and Redis, including performance tuning and schema design.
- Experience with A/B testing frameworks and using analytics to drive product decisions.
- Familiarity with CMS (preferably Payload).
- Leadership & CollaborationDemonstrated ability to mentor other engineers and elevate team performance.Clear communication style, able to explain complex topics clearly and concisely.A proactive mindset, you spot issues before they become problems and take ownership.Comfortable making technical decisions and defending them with logic and data.Experience leading teams or projects.
- Demonstrated ability to mentor other engineers and elevate team performance.
- Clear communication style, able to explain complex topics clearly and concisely.
- A proactive mindset, you spot issues before they become problems and take ownership.
- Comfortable making technical decisions and defending them with logic and data.
- Experience leading teams or projects.
Preferred Qualifications
- Experience in D2C SaaS products.
- Exposure to performance marketing, customer funnel optimization, or rapid MVP cycles.
- Contributions to open-source or technical blogs.
- Experience working in a fast-paced, high-growth startup environment.
- Experience in D2C SaaS products.
- Exposure to performance marketing, customer funnel optimization, or rapid MVP cycles.
- Contributions to open-source or technical blogs.
- Experience working in a fast-paced, high-growth startup environment.
Skills & Technologies
CI/CDNext.jsJavaScriptTypeScriptDockerAWSPostgreSQLRedisRubyGo
About the Company
Ruby Labs
View company profile →
Interested in this role?
Sign in or create a free account to see how this job matches your skills, apply with one click, and let our AI tailor your resume.
Sign in to applyAI-powered resume optimization
Save and track your applications
Job Details
Employment Type
Full Time
Experience Level
Senior
Salary Range
$120,000 – $200,000
Location
USA
Work Mode
Remote
Posted
26 days ago
Country
US